summ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
-rw-r--r--Dozentenmodul/bin/Models/Image.classbin2387 -> 2387 bytes
-rw-r--r--Dozentenmodul/bin/Models/Lecture.classbin2226 -> 2226 bytes
-rw-r--r--Dozentenmodul/bin/Models/person.classbin2032 -> 2032 bytes
-rw-r--r--Dozentenmodul/src/Models/Image.java3
-rw-r--r--Dozentenmodul/src/Models/Lecture.java3
-rw-r--r--Dozentenmodul/src/Models/person.java5
-rw-r--r--Dozentenmodulserver/bin/server/BinaryListener.classbin3002 -> 3344 bytes
-rw-r--r--Dozentenmodulserver/bin/util/XMLCreator.classbin7557 -> 7558 bytes
-rw-r--r--Dozentenmodulserver/src/server/BinaryListener.java46
9 files changed, 26 insertions, 31 deletions
diff --git a/Dozentenmodul/bin/Models/Image.class b/Dozentenmodul/bin/Models/Image.class
index 59b34fab..0167c7c5 100644
--- a/Dozentenmodul/bin/Models/Image.class
+++ b/Dozentenmodul/bin/Models/Image.class
Binary files differ
diff --git a/Dozentenmodul/bin/Models/Lecture.class b/Dozentenmodul/bin/Models/Lecture.class
index a0cb753d..31755bcf 100644
--- a/Dozentenmodul/bin/Models/Lecture.class
+++ b/Dozentenmodul/bin/Models/Lecture.class
Binary files differ
diff --git a/Dozentenmodul/bin/Models/person.class b/Dozentenmodul/bin/Models/person.class
index 36fa9761..ef2a89eb 100644
--- a/Dozentenmodul/bin/Models/person.class
+++ b/Dozentenmodul/bin/Models/person.class
Binary files differ
diff --git a/Dozentenmodul/src/Models/Image.java b/Dozentenmodul/src/Models/Image.java
index 0b3c936e..e08ed5a2 100644
--- a/Dozentenmodul/src/Models/Image.java
+++ b/Dozentenmodul/src/Models/Image.java
@@ -1,9 +1,9 @@
package models;
public class Image {
+
private String ImageId;
private String version;
-
private String imagename;
private String newName;
private String imagepath;
@@ -12,7 +12,6 @@ public class Image {
private int ram;
private int cpu;
private long filesize;
-
public static Image image =new Image();
diff --git a/Dozentenmodul/src/Models/Lecture.java b/Dozentenmodul/src/Models/Lecture.java
index 6b7e6fa1..eae05ec5 100644
--- a/Dozentenmodul/src/Models/Lecture.java
+++ b/Dozentenmodul/src/Models/Lecture.java
@@ -4,7 +4,6 @@ import java.util.Date;
public class Lecture {
-
private String name;
private String newName;
private String shortDesc;
@@ -14,8 +13,6 @@ public class Lecture {
private boolean active;
private String id;
private String linkedImagename;
-
-
public static Lecture lecture =new Lecture();
diff --git a/Dozentenmodul/src/Models/person.java b/Dozentenmodul/src/Models/person.java
index 67b6b84e..0f14af51 100644
--- a/Dozentenmodul/src/Models/person.java
+++ b/Dozentenmodul/src/Models/person.java
@@ -3,9 +3,7 @@ package models;
public class person{
-
private String username;
-
private String Name;
private String Vorname;
private String Hochschule;
@@ -13,11 +11,8 @@ public class person{
private String Tel;
private String Fakultaet;
private boolean ischecked;
-
- //public static person verantowrtlicher=new person();
public static person verantwortlicher=new person();
-
public String getUsername() {
return username;
}
diff --git a/Dozentenmodulserver/bin/server/BinaryListener.class b/Dozentenmodulserver/bin/server/BinaryListener.class
index 81db32c2..3518f758 100644
--- a/Dozentenmodulserver/bin/server/BinaryListener.class
+++ b/Dozentenmodulserver/bin/server/BinaryListener.class
Binary files differ
diff --git a/Dozentenmodulserver/bin/util/XMLCreator.class b/Dozentenmodulserver/bin/util/XMLCreator.class
index cfdf6004..0c9c6d45 100644
--- a/Dozentenmodulserver/bin/util/XMLCreator.class
+++ b/Dozentenmodulserver/bin/util/XMLCreator.class
Binary files differ
diff --git a/Dozentenmodulserver/src/server/BinaryListener.java b/Dozentenmodulserver/src/server/BinaryListener.java
index acf92a89..172b910b 100644
--- a/Dozentenmodulserver/src/server/BinaryListener.java
+++ b/Dozentenmodulserver/src/server/BinaryListener.java
@@ -11,34 +11,38 @@ import org.apache.thrift.transport.TServerSocket;
import org.apache.thrift.transport.TServerTransport;
import org.apache.thrift.transport.TTransportException;
-public class BinaryListener implements Runnable
-{
- private static Logger log = Logger.getLogger( BinaryListener.class );
+public class BinaryListener implements Runnable {
+ private static Logger log = Logger.getLogger(BinaryListener.class);
+
+ private final int MINWORKERTHREADS = 20; // keine ahnung ob das passt...
+ private final int MAXWORKERTHREADS = 80; // ebenso
@Override
- public void run()
- {
+ public void run() {
final ServerHandler handler = new ServerHandler();
- final Server.Processor<ServerHandler> processor = new Server.Processor<ServerHandler>( handler );
+ final Server.Processor<ServerHandler> processor = new Server.Processor<ServerHandler>(
+ handler);
final TServerTransport transport;
- final TProtocolFactory protFactory = new TBinaryProtocolSafe.Factory( true, true );
+ final TProtocolFactory protFactory = new TBinaryProtocolSafe.Factory(
+ true, true);
try {
- transport = new TServerSocket( 9090 );
- log.info(new Date()+" - Connected to Port 9090");
- } catch ( TTransportException e ) {
- log.fatal( new Date() +" - Could not listen on port 9090" );
+ transport = new TServerSocket(9090);
+ log.info(new Date() + " - Connected to Port 9090");
+
+ } catch (TTransportException e) {
+ log.fatal(new Date() + " - Could not listen on port 9090");
return;
}
- //TServer server = new TSimpleServer( new Args( transport ).processor( processor ) );
- //TServer server = new TThreadPoolServer( new Args( transport ).protocolFactory( protFactory ).processor( processor ).minWorkerThreads( 4 ).maxWorkerThreads( 8 ) );
- //TServer server = new TThreadPoolServer( new Args( transport ).protocolFactory( protFactory ).processor( processor ) );
- //TThreadPoolServer server = new TThreadPoolServer( new Args( transport ).protocolFactory( protFactory ).processor( processor ).minWorkerThreads( 4 ).maxWorkerThreads( 8 ) );
-
- TServer server = new TThreadPoolServer( new Args( transport ).protocolFactory( protFactory ).processor( processor ).minWorkerThreads( 4 ).maxWorkerThreads( 8 ) );
-
- log.info(new Date() +" - Started running BinaryListener");
+ TServer server = new TThreadPoolServer(new Args(transport)
+ .protocolFactory(protFactory).processor(processor)
+ .minWorkerThreads(MINWORKERTHREADS)
+ .maxWorkerThreads(MAXWORKERTHREADS));
+
+ log.info(new Date() + " - Started running BinaryListener");
+ log.info(new Date() + " - MINWORKERTHREADS=" + MINWORKERTHREADS
+ + " and MAXWORKERTHREADS=" + MAXWORKERTHREADS+"\n");
server.serve();
-
+
}
-
+
}